HC Deb 23 March 1979 vol 964 c290W
Mr. Arthur Lewis

asked the Secretary of State for Social Services whether he is aware that some local authorities are making a charge for the replacement of the physically disabled motorists' orange disc; whether this charge is made with his authority; and whether he will take action to stop this practice.

Mr. Horam

I have been asked to reply.

The regulations governing the scheme provide for local authorities to make a charge of up to £1 for the issue of a badge, which is valid for three years, as a contribution towards administrative costs. The amount, fixed in 1975, does not seem excessive.
